Octet lattice-based plate for elastic wave control
Giulia Aguzzi1, Constantinos Kanellopoulos2, Richard Wiltshaw3
1Department of Civil, Environmental and Geomatic Engineering, ETH Zürich, Zürich, 8093, Switzerland. aguzzi@ibk.baug.ethz.ch.
This study explores octet-lattice metastructures for controlling flexural waves in plates. Customized designs enable effective wave mitigation and focusing, offering new possibilities for vibration isolation and energy manipulation.
Area of Science:
- * Solid Mechanics
- * Metamaterials
- * Acoustics
Background:
- * Lattice structures are crucial in various scientific and engineering fields.
- * Metastructures offer unique wave manipulation capabilities, including mitigation and guiding.
- * Octet-topology lattices provide a foundation for advanced metamaterial designs.
Purpose of the Study:
- * To numerically investigate flexural wave propagation in octet-lattice metastructures.
- * To design and analyze metabarriers for wave inhibition and metalenses for wave guiding.
- * To explore the impact of added masses and variable node thickness on wave phenomena.
Main Methods:
- * Numerical determination of dispersion curves for octet-lattice arrays.
- * Design and simulation of metabarriers and metalenses (Luneburg and Maxwell types).
- * Parametric analysis of added masses and node thickness for graded designs.
Main Results:
- * A broad bandgap was identified and utilized to create effective metabarriers for wave transmission inhibition.
- * Graded designs incorporating added masses and variable node thickness enabled wave filtering via rainbow trapping.
- * Luneburg and Maxwell metalenses successfully steered wavefronts to a focal point.
Conclusions:
- * Octet-like lattices are versatile for designing advanced metastructures.
- * The study demonstrates effective wave mitigation and focusing using customized octet designs.
- * Results offer new perspectives for applications in vibration isolation and energy focusing.
